Approved: 091718 Minutes Education Advisory Committee (EAC) August 20, 2018 City Hall Attendees Members Present Absent David Toledo, Dist 1 __X __ Dawn Powers, Dist 2 __X __ Melissa Day, Dist 3 __X __ Carolyn Bernache, Dist 4 __X __ Doris Ellis, Dist 4 _X __ Daniel First __X __ Also Present Peggy Higgins, City Liaison Carleveva Thompson, Contract Secretary Call to Order Ms. Bernache called the meeting to order at 7:47pm. Old Business Approval of the May Minutes The committee reviewed the meeting minutes from the May 21, 2018 meeting. Mr. Toledo made a motion to approve the May meeting minutes as written. Second by Ms. Day. All members were in favor and the May meeting minutes were approved. School Supply Delivery schedule/Review of letter to Principals Ms. Bernache has purchased the school supplies to deliver to the schools and a letter has been drafted to provide with the supplies. A news article stated that the green crayon from the Dollar Store crayons has a trace amount of lead asbestos, but the crayons will not be recalled. The committee decided to remove the green crayons and include a statement in the letter explaining why the green crayons have been removed. Ms. Powers made a motion to remove all the green crayons. Second by Ms. Bernache and all members were in favor. The following committee members volunteered to deliver the school supplies: Mr. Toledo: Hollywood and Paint Branch Ms. Day: Berwyn Heights and University Park Ms. Bernache and Ms. Ellis: Buck Lodge and Cherokee Lane School supplies should be delivered by September 4th. Firstbooks orders for College Park Day Ms. Higgins has a student volunteer that can add the stickers to the books for community service hours. The EAC members can pick up the books from the Community Center after the stickers have been attached. New Business Review of draft EAC Annual Report The committee reviewed the draft annual report and the following items will be added: Accomplishments – The number of scholarships issued to students and the number of students that attended summer camp. • Goals – Increase outreach - Consider new project of providing a grant for purchasing books for college students • Objectives - Reinstate the summer camp essay contest • Issues – new members needed on the committee Adjournment Ms. Bernache adjourned the meeting at 8:39pm.
